For you SPAD lovers, you can still find the HC SPAD Xlll, I didn't like the fact that there was no engine, I got a Roden SPAD Vll, and did what the SPAD Co did, copied the Vll engine mount and modified it slightly, only I used sheet plastic. then Roden made the write engine Hispano Suiza 8AB (Roden Kit #625) Then painted the SPAD in the typical AEF 5 color pattern. I got SuperScale Decal MS320242 for the Nieuport 28 for the 27th Aero Squadron. I used only Edward Eliot's number 9, since he also flew SPAD Xllls, and the Eagle through the roundel, which was the perfect size for the SPAD. If you want to try and find white outlined black 2s you could make Luke's plane from these decals. There are various after market parts for the SPAD Xlll and great online builds, so why wait for something that may not come. (watch it be this Dec)
